We compared two Desktop platform GPUs: 2GB VRAM Radeon HD 8760 OEM and 12GB VRAM TITAN V to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
AMD Radeon HD 8760 OEM 's Advantages
Lower TDP (80W vs 250W)
NVIDIA TITAN V 's Advantages
Released 4 years and 11 months late
Boost Clock1455MHz
More VRAM (12GB vs 2GB)
Larger VRAM bandwidth (651.3GB/s vs 72.00GB/s)
4480 additional rendering cores
